3x-2y=23
X-3y=3
Which system of equations has the same solution as the system of equations shown ?

Answers

Answer 1

The solution of the given system of equation are  x = 9 and y = 2.

What is an equation?

An equation is an expression that shows the relationship between two or more numbers and variables.

A mathematical equation is a statement with two equal sides and an equal sign in between. An equation is, for instance, 4 + 6 = 10. Both 4 + 6 and 10 can be seen on the left and right sides of the equal sign, respectively.

We are given that the system of equation as;

3x-2y=23

X-3y=3

x = 3 + 3y

Now using substitution method, we get;

3x-2y=23

3(3 + 3y)-2y=23

9 + 9y - 2y = 23

7y = 23 - 9

7y = 14

y = 2

So, x = 3 + 3(2) = 9

Therefore, the solution are x = 9 and y = 2.

7(4n-6)=6+4(4+3n) what’s the answer show work please

Answers

Step-by-step explanation:

7(4n−6)=6+4(4+3n)

Step 1: Simplify both sides of the equation.

7(4n−6)=6+4(4+3n)

(7)(4n)+(7)(−6)=6+(4)(4)+(4)(3n) (Distribute)

28n+−42=6+16+12n

28n−42=(12n)+(6+16) (Combine Like Terms)

28n−42=12n+22

Step 2: Subtract 12n from both sides.

28n−42−12n=12n+22−12n

16n−42=22

Step 3: Add 42 to both sides.

16n−42+42=22+42

16n=64

Step 4: Divide both sides by 16.

[tex]\frac{16n}{16} = \frac{64}{16}[/tex]

n=4

What type of system of linear equation has at least one solution?

Answers

The Consistent System Of Linear equations have at least one Solution , and the inconsistent system of linear equations have No Solution .

Let the system of two linear equations be given as :  [tex]a_{1}x +b_{1}y =c_{1}[/tex] and [tex]a_{2}x +b_{2}y =c_{2}[/tex] ;

Case(i) If the equations satisfies the condition :  [tex]\frac{a_{1} }{a_{2} } \neq \frac{b_{1} }{b_{2} }[/tex] ,

then linear equations has a unique solution and solutions are called as consistent .

Case(ii) If the equations satisfies the condition :  [tex]\frac{a_{1} }{a_{2} } = \frac{b_{1} }{b_{2} } = \frac{c_{1} }{c_{2} }[/tex]  ,

then linear equations has infinitely many solution and the solutions are called consistent .

Case(iii) If the equations satisfies the condition : [tex]\frac{a_{1} }{a_{2} } = \frac{b_{1} }{b_{2} } \neq \frac{c_{1} }{c_{2} }[/tex]  ,

then the linear equations has No Solution and the solutions are called as inconsistent .

Therefore  , if system has at least one solution , then solutions are consistent .

A consumer watchdog organization estimates the mean weight of 1-ounce "Fun-Size"
candy bars to see if customers are getting full value for their money. A random sample
of 25 bars is selected and weighted, and the organization reports that a 95% confidence
interval for the true mean weight of the candy bars is 0.982 to 0.988 ounces.
a) What is the point estimate (=sample mean) from this sample?
b) What is the margin of error?
(Hint: find the distance between the sample mean and the upper limit).
c) Interpret the confidence level of 90% in the context of the problem?

Answers

Point estimate from the sample is 0.985, margin error is 0.003.

What is Confidence Interval?

Confidence interval is defined as the interval which is the estimate for the parameter of the sample or population to be contained.

(a) To calculate point estimate or sample mean :

Point estimate is the mid point of the confidence interval.

Given that true mean weight of candy bars is 0.982 ounces to 0.988 ounces.

Point estimate = (0.982 + 0.988) / 2 = 1.97 / 2 = 0.985

(b) Margin error is the one half of the total width of the interval.

Margin error = (0.988 - 0.982) / 2 = 0.003

(c) The confidence level of 90% in this problem can be interpreted as , if we do the interval construction for many times, about 90% of the total constructed intervals has the true population mean of weight of fun size candy bars.

Hence the point estimate and margin error are 0.985 and 0.003 respectively.

If the basin is completely filled with water, how much water will it hold? round the answer to the nearest tenth of a foot. ft3

Answers

A cylindrical basin is 2 feet tall and has a diameter of 5 feet, as shown. If the basin is completely filled with water, how much water will it hold? Round the answer to the nearest tenth of a foot.

The basin holds 39.3 cubic feet of water.

The volume of a cylinder is the number of unit cubes (cubes of unit length) that can be fit into it. It is the space occupied by the cylinder as the volume of any three-dimensional shape is the space occupied by it. The volume of a cylinder is measured in cubic units such as cm3, m3, in3, etc. Let us see the formula used to calculate the volume of a cylinder. We know that the base of a right circular cylinder is a circle and the area of a circle of radius 'r' is πr2. Thus, the volume (V) of a right circular cylinder, using the above formula, is,

V = πr²h

Here,

⇒ 'r' is the radius of the base (circle) of the cylinder

⇒ 'h' is the height of the cylinder

⇒ π is a constant whose value is either 22/7 (or) 3.142.

Thus, the volume of cylinder directly varies with its height and directly varies with the square of its radius. i.e., if the radius of the cylinder becomes double, then its volume becomes four times.

We are given that the height of the basin h = 2 ft and the diameter = d = 5 ft.

So, radius r = d/2 = 5/2 = 2.5 ft

The amount of water the basin holds is equal to the volume of cylindrical basin.

Volume =πr²h

=3.1416×2.5²×2

=39.27 cubic feet

= 39.3 cubic feet

Thus, the basin holds 39.3 cubic feet of water.

In the year 2000, the United States had a population of about 281.4 million people; by 2010, the population had risen to about 308.7 million. Part A Find the 10-year continuous growth rate using

Answers

The 10 years continuous growth rate as calculated is 0.9259 % per year and the equation to model the population growth of the United States, and is used it to estimate the population in 2020 is  P = 281.4e^(0.009 259t); 338.6 million  .

Given,

P₀ = 281.4 million

P  = 308.7 million

To calculate the growth rate

t = 2010 - 2000 = 10 yr

P = P₀e^(rt)

308.7 = 281.4e^(10r)

e^(10r) = 1.0970

10r = ln1.0970

r = (ln1.0970)/10 = (0.092 59)/10 = 0.009 259  

r = 0.9259 % per year

To find the equation of population model

P = 281.4e^(0.009 259t)

here , P is in millions and

the number of years passed since 2002 is represented as t.

P = 281.4e^(0.009 259 × 20) = 281.4e^0.1852 = 281.4 × 1.203

P = 338.6 million

Therefore, the population in 2020 is assumed to be 338.6 million.
